Djinn of Infinite Deceits

2 printings available

Djinn of Infinite Deceits

Commander Anthology

CMA #38 Jun 2017
Rare
Regular $0.78
Foil -
Regular €0.42
Foil -
View
Current
Djinn of Infinite Deceits

Commander 2013

C13 #41 Nov 2013
Rare
Regular $0.84
Foil -
Regular €0.39
Foil -
View